Bioenterprise Canada Corporation is pleased to partner with the Ontario Ministry of Agriculture, Food and Rural Affairs (OMAFRA) to support the delivery of stream C (Commercialization) of the Ontario Agri-Food Research Initiative (OAFRI). This initiative is supported with up to $2 million in funding from Canadian Agricultural Partnership (CAP) and OMAFRA.

 

The OAFRI Commercialization stream is designed to provide Ontario’s agriculture, agri-food, and agri-based products sectors, including technology or equipment suppliers, access to funding to support commercialization projects with a focus on Market Validation and Product Development activities. These efforts aim to enhance competitiveness and the leadership position of Ontario in the agriculture and agri-food sectors.

 

The OAFRI Commercialization stream will provide funding for two project types:

 

Project Type A: Market Validation Grants

Conduct market research to determine the size and quality of the market opportunity for a new and promising technology, product, or service with the goal of determining if there is any market potential before more research funds are spent on the technology.

Funding Available: up to $30,000 per project

 

Project Type B: Product Development Grants

Create prototypes, perform field trials, remove any barriers to a market launch or private sector adoption and optimize a minimum viable product that best meets the needs of customers. 

Funding Available: $50,000-$150,000 per project
